MAIL NOTICES.

XEW PLYMOUTH. for Auckland and Xoi'th, por steamer, Tuesday and Friday, at 7 p.in , and daily per train, at 6.15 a.m. For Wellington and South, daily, per train, at 6.15 a.m. and 12.20 p.m. For Wanganui and intermediate offices, per train, at 6.15 a.m., 12f20 and 3.55 p.m. SATURDAY, MAY 9. For Australian States and South Africa (per s.s. Makura from Auckland), at 6.15 a.m. TUESDAY, MAY 12. For Fiji (per s.s. Kavua, from Auckland), lit (i.15 a.m. THURSDAY, MAY 11. Fur Australian States, South Africa, Ceylon, India, China, Japan, East Indies, Straits Settlements, Eastern and Mediterranean ports, United Kingdom and Continent of Europe, at 12.20 p.m. Due London .Tune 21. (Money orders close 11 a.m.) FRIDAY, MAY 15. For Tasmania, via Bluff, at 0.15 a.m. SATURDAY,, MAY 10. For Australian States and South Africa, via Auckland, at 6.15 a.m. TUESDAY, MAY II). Parcel mail for United Kingdom, Continent of Europe, West Indies, 'Central America, United States of America and Canada, via San Francisco; also Tahiti and Rarotonga (pur s.s. Willochra, from Wellington), at 12.20 p.m. (Correspondence for Continent of Europe must be specially addressed "via 'Frisco"). Duo ijondon June 22. (Money orders close 4 p.m. Wednesday for U.S.A. and Canada).

Unless otherwise specified, money orders and registered letters close one hour, and parcel-post parcels thirty minutes, before the ordinary mail.
